Adobe Flash Pros: self-contained, highly flexible software package. Relatively to easy to build complex interactive narrative stories. Author has complete control over design, narrative structure and multimedia elements Cons: expensive software. Doesn’t work on iOS devices (iphones, ipads etc). Requires basic understanding of Actionscript coding

Wordpress www.wordpress.orgwww.wordpress.org or www.wordpress.comwww.wordpress.com Pros: highly customisable open-source content management system. Can be built using browser – no need for proprietary software. Large community – so lots of online help. Easy to try new designs. Cons: security from hackers not great. Quality control of ‘plugins’ is poor. A lot of wordpress sites have same basic structure – so can get samey. For wordpress.com you need your own hosting set-up (CfJ provides this for students)

Medium www.medium.com Pros: long-form narrative platform. Very straightforward to build scrolling narrative pieces Cons: Not many options over basic design structure. Your content is hosted on their platform – so will only exist as long as their business survives

Interlude www.interlude.fm Pros: video-based interactive storytelling tool. Intuitive,rowser-based planning and creation interface. Cons: Limited options over structure of pieces. Your content is hosted on their platform – so will only exist as long as their business survives.

Racontr www.racontr.com Pros. Drag and drop dashboard allows you to build interactive scenarios based on templates. Quite a flexible system in terms of design. Cons. More complex than some browser- based platforms. Free account allows max of 100mB of media. Your content is hosted on their platform – so will only exist as long as their business survives.

Storybench www.storybench.com Pros. Not so much of a platform, more a collection of DIY tools to enable you to build specific types of project. Cons. Some projects require a relatively high degree of coding/understanding of web architecture

Wix.com www.wix.com Pros. Very simple template-based web site creation. Makes good-looking stories very easy to create. No coding knowledge required. Cons. Limited number of design templates, so a lot of content looks the same. Your content is hosted on their platform – so will only exist as long as their business survives.
